

PICA Cultural Activities: Music, Dance, Film, Excursions, …
In addition to the extensive Paris cultural activities offered in Paris, the PICA semester-long programs also take part in additional excursions outside Paris. Each semester program includes one weekend excursion to places such as Normandy, Burgundy, Strasbourg, Loire Valley Chateaux and others. Additionally, there will be two day-long trips from Paris to visit nearby sites such as Versailles, Chantilly, Monet’s house and garden in Giverny, Provins, Troyes, Chartres, Fontainebleau–among other options.
Each semester we will arrange a series of special events which may include walking tours and guided museum visits, film screenings, live dance or musical performances.
The PICA short term programs in January and during the Summer will likewise take advantage of sites nearby Paris for one or two day trips. Among these trips: the royal palace of Versailles, The palace and park of Fontainebleau, beautiful medieval towns Provins et Troyes as well as others.
